PROFAST: A randomised trial implementing enhanced recovery after surgery for highcomplexity advanced ovarian cancer surgery.

Abstract

Enhanced recovery after surgery (ERAS) programs include multiple perioperative elements designed to achieve early recovery after surgery and a shorter length of stay (LOS) in hospital. The PROFAST trial aimed to expand the evidence base for implementing ERAS in advanced gynaecologic oncology surgery. This prospective, interventional randomised clinical trial enrolled women undergoing surgery for either suspected or diagnosed advanced ovarian cancer, at a reference hospital in gynaecologic oncology in Barcelona (Spain) and who were treated after either an ERAS protocol or conventional management (CM) protocol. All enrolled women who underwent cytoreductive surgery were included in the primary analysis. The primary outcome was reduction in LOS, and secondary outcomes were incidence and type of intraoperative and postoperative complications, rate of readmission and mortality within a 30-d follow-up period. This trial is registered at ClinicalTrials.gov, number NCT02172638. From June 2014 to March 2018, 110 women were recruited, of which eleven were excluded.
